Padgate to Elstree & Borehamwood by train

Planning a train journey from Padgate to Elstree & Borehamwood? The trip usually takes about 5hrs 41 mins, covering approximately 154 miles (248 kilometres). With roughly 29 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£43.50,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Padgate to Elstree & Borehamwood start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Padgate to Elstree & Borehamwood start from £70.00 one way, or £100.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Padgate to Elstree & Borehamwood are available for £169.80 one way, or £339.60 return

Station Facilities and Ticketing Information

Padgate Train Station does not have a fully-fledged ticket office, but it is equipped with ticket machines that can be used to purchase and collect tickets at any time. These machines are user-friendly and accessible to all passengers, including those with disabilities, thanks to their induction loops. It is necessary to remember that Padgate Station does not have staff assistance readily available, although help is just a phone call away via the customer helpline at 08002006060. For those requiring extra accessibility, such as step-free access or ramps, Padgate does offer level access in certain areas of the station.

Travel Connections from Padgate Station

While Padgate Train Station is modest in size, it serves as a central hub for various travel connections. Options include a rail replacement service, which provides convenient pick-up and drop-off points on Station Road for journeys to Manchester and Warrington. For taxi services, passengers can make use of local cab options through services such as Cab4You, or opt for bus services via Busline at 0871 200 2233. However, it’s important to note that there are no bicycle storage facilities available at the station itself.

Facilities at Elstree & Borehamwood

Elstree & Borehamwood station is equipped with several amenities to ensure a comfortable experience. The ticket office is open every day of the week, with longer hours on Sunday (06:30 to 21:15). If you prefer self-service, there are ticket machines available that also support the issuing of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. In case you've purchased your tickets online, you can collect them using these machines.

Catering to accessibility needs, the station provides step-free access to all platforms. For those requiring assistance, Elstree & Borehamwood station is staffed throughout the day to help passengers navigate the station or board trains. The Help Point acts as a convenient resource for real-time travel information or emergencies, supported by CCTV surveillance ensuring your safety. Although there's no waiting room, seating areas are present for your comfort.
